Key Features Comparison

Sysinternals Desktops
Sysinternals Desktops Features
  • Create multiple virtual desktops to organize applications and files
  • Easily switch between desktops with keyboard shortcuts or the desktop manager
  • Customize desktop names, wallpapers and settings for each virtual workspace
  • Move windows between desktops by dragging and dropping
  • Supports multiple monitors with independent desktop layouts
  • Save and load desktop configurations for quick access later
